Which Exam Shall I Do in Order to Know What is Wrong with my Chin Implant?

I had a revision chin implant and I now have two pockets. One should be contracting and disappearing according to my doctor. The other pocket is where the implant was placed. It's been seven months and I am still numb and feel uncomfortable with my chin implant. It bothers me so much. I have this burning sensation at times. Everyone is advising me to do something different in terms of getting an exam. Which do I do an x-ray, CT scan or MRI? Should I be feeling like this at seven months?
